The role of microscopes has expanded over time. Gone were the days that microscopes were very delicate objects, which can be used inside the confines of a laboratory alone. Today, microscopes can be brought over the field for an actual and real-time study of plants, animals, and all other things that are relevant to the acquisition of knowledge and research.
This feat is made possible by field microscopy. Field microscopes are the microscopes that are built for the road, the wild, and the great outdoors. But despite its rugged features, it can certainly function inside a traditional laboratory as well.
To make it work, these microscopes are mounted on tripods or boom stands. These stands allow the microscopes to be used in any surface. It can even be placed directly over the ground. It is very unlike traditional microscopes that need to be laid property on its bottom, preferably a lab table or bench, so that it can work as desired.
Field microscopes are strong and rough type of microscopes built with an extra durable exterior. But of course, the lenses and the glasses that are used with this type of a microscope are made with quality materials only. Most of the time, high-grade optics is used, especially for professional field microscopes that are used by geologists, archeologists, marine biologists and similar experts.
Of course, field microscopes are very portable devices. They are not too light or too heavy to bring around. Their weight is just right. It is built in a very compact design, making it very easy for users to put it inside their backpacks or carrying bags. Right now, traveling safely with the microscope in tow is very possible.
Field microscopes come in different shapes and forms. In fact, there are a lot of them that doesn’t look like a microscope at all. Some look just like telescope mounted on a stand. The microscope’s outward appearance, however, is of least importance. The more important element of course, is the microscope’s ability to magnify specimens in the desired value.
When buying field microscopes, it is important that both the specifications and package is checked. The microscope’s optical system should comply with the DIN standard, first and foremost. The optics is the bloodline of all microscopes, not only by field microscopes. It is very important that the optics works as expected.
When it comes to objectives, only a handful of field microscopes are compound microscopes. This means that only one objective can be used at a time. But this doesn’t imply that you will be restricted with only one type of objective lens to use all throughout. Of course, you should be able to change the objectives so that you can enlarge the specimen to as big as you want it to be. The standard objective of a field microscope, depending upon its complexity of course, is 4x. But there are optional objectives that you can use with it, so that you can achieve both high power and low power magnification. For high power, you can use the 100x magnification objective. For low power, as 2.5x objective is available.
Eyepieces work in conjunction with objective lenses. For all types of microscopes, the standard is the eyepiece with 10x magnification power. Alternately, you can use a 5x or a 15x to 20x eyepiece lens with a field microscope. But then again, all of these are optional accessories. When buying field microscopes, make sure that you get the one with the objective and eyepiece set that would work for you best. Remember that most sets come with only one eyepiece and one objective. Choose the value that will prove to be most useful for you.
Don’t forget about the microscope’s adjustment knobs. It is essential that field microscopes are equipped with these as well. The adjustment knobs are the ones that allows for a clearer, crisper, and better view of the image being observed. Ideally, both the coarse and fine adjustment knobs should be present. With field microscopes, samples need not be taken from the site into the laboratory. Instead, the microscopes can be brought to the site for easy assessment, observation, and analysis. This is very important, especially when time and travel of the specimens is a factor.
